Looking back to look ahead

David Perry -- Furniture Today, January 26, 2003

Sometimes the best way to know where you're headed is to look back at where you've been.

With that thought in mind, we asked bedding executives to tell us what surprised them about business last year. We weren't surprised that they offered us a variety of thoughtful, insightful answers to that question. They serve as a reminder that as the industry aims to boost unit and dollar sales in 2003, there could be some unexpected twists and turns along the way.

Will the surprises of 2002 be repeated in 2003? Or will we see some new surprises? Keep those questions in mind as you read these candid thoughts of leading bedding executives.
